Understanding Proxy Protocols: HTTP and HTTPS

Before diving into the specifics of the PyProxy residential proxy pool, it's essential to grasp what HTTP and HTTPS are and how they differ. Both protocols are the foundation of communication on the web, but they serve different purposes in terms of security.

- HTTP (Hypertext Transfer Protocol) is the standard protocol used for transmitting web pages on the internet. It is an unsecured protocol, meaning that the data exchanged between the client and server is not encrypted. While HTTP is still widely used for less sensitive data, it lacks the protection needed for secure transactions.

- HTTPS (Hypertext Transfer Protocol Secure), on the other hand, is a more secure version of HTTP. It incorporates encryption through SSL/TLS (Secure Sockets Layer/Transport Layer Security) to protect the integrity and confidentiality of the data transmitted. HTTPS is commonly used for transactions involving sensitive information, such as online banking, e-commerce, and email.

Both protocols are critical for different use cases, and understanding how proxies interact with them is vital for choosing the right solution.

The Role of residential proxies in Modern Online Activities

Residential proxies are a unique class of proxies that use IP addresses assigned to real residential devices, rather than data center-based servers. This makes them appear as legitimate users to websites, which reduces the chances of being blocked or flagged for suspicious activity. These proxies are often used for web scraping, managing multiple social media accounts, circumventing geo-restrictions, and maintaining online privacy.

How PyProxy Handles HTTP and HTTPS Requests

PyProxy's proxy pool works by routing incoming requests through residential IP addresses and ensuring that they conform to the desired protocol. The process of handling HTTP and HTTPS requests is streamlined to maintain fast connection speeds while ensuring reliability and security.

- HTTP Requests: When an HTTP request is made, PyProxy routes it through one of its available residential IP addresses, forwarding the request to the destination server. Since HTTP does not require encryption, the proxy performs a straightforward forwarding operation, ensuring a fast and efficient connection.

- HTTPS Requests: For HTTPS requests, the proxy pool performs additional steps to ensure that the SSL/TLS handshake is properly handled. PyProxy securely forwards the encrypted traffic between the client and the destination server, ensuring that sensitive information is protected during transmission.

The ability to handle both HTTP and HTTPS traffic efficiently is an important feature for users who require a proxy service that can seamlessly work across different web applications and scenarios.
